The Smelly Truth About Cabbage Soup
Here’s the thing—cabbage does have some gut-friendly nutrients. But eating nothing but cabbage soup for days? Big yikes. Let’s talk about what’s really happening:
Gut Chaos, Not Gut Health: Cabbage is high in fiber and sulfur. Sounds good, right? Not when it’s the only thing on the menu. That fiber overload hits your digestive system like a wrecking ball—cue the bloating, cramping, and endless bathroom trips. And let’s not forget that delightful rotten-egg aroma.
No Crunch, All Sog: Texture matters. The gut loves variety—crunchy veggies, hearty proteins, healthy fats. A bowl of limp, boiled cabbage? Your taste buds (and stomach) deserve better. Trust us, no one is sticking to a plan that smells like a boiled vegetable factory and has zero satisfaction factor.
Temporary Results, Long-Term Misery: Any weight loss? Mostly water and muscle. The second you return to real food, your body rebounds—hard. Your gut’s been through the wringer, and guess what? You’re right back where you started.
